Tenor Toal goes back to school
1:00pm Tuesday 16th October 2012 in News
Caption - Paul Goddard (left) and Anne Scanlon presenting the school cap to Martin Toal, watched by pupils.
THE internationally renowned Tenor – Martin Toal returned to his former primary school – All Saints Catholic Primary School in Sale, to perform at a special concert.
Martin was presented with his original school cap to mark his return by headteacher Anne Scanlon, who is pictured above along with Paul Goddard (the Deputy Lieutenant of Manchester and vice governor of the School), teacher Louise Keegan (organiser of the visit) and children from the School.
The concert which was staged with pupils from the school was to mark the visit from a group of 30 teachers from around Europe who were visiting the School as part of the Comenius Project which is a two year scheme funded by the British Council. The aim of the project is to develop links between the UK and the six partner schools in Europe.
Martin was asked how he felt about returning to his former School and commented:“It brought back some lovely memories.”
